Neuralink will cure depression says Elon Musk

Elon Musk, the man behind the neurotechnology start-up announced Neuralink will cure depression and addiction by ‘re-training’ the mind.

Elon Musk is always one step ahead of our perceptions, He goes above and beyond to impress our psyche, every time with a new innovation. His futuristic ventures have touched a new high yet again when he announced that his brain chip company Neuralink will cure depression.  

The first thought that most of us had on receiving this news is, of course, incredulity. But Elon Musk is known both to share unbelievable ideas as well as deliver ambitious projects successfully. 

The announcement posted on Twitter by Musk himself is being viewed with apprehension and excitement. In fact, Elon Musk himself says that the idea is scary but is determined for his company to reach its desired intent. 

Elon Musk recently stunned the world with his impressive SpaceX launch, one of his many achievements. Similarly, Neuralink which was founded in 2016 had earlier made headlines with its efforts towards developing interfaces that make it possible to stream music from inside one’s brain. 

Elon Musk affirmed a computer engineer’s speculation on Twitter about how Neuralink will cure depression by ‘re-training’ parts of the brain that give rise to these conditions. 

He replied with the statement,

‘For sure. This is both great & terrifying’ Everything we’ve ever sensed or thought has been electrical signals.’

The astonishing fact is that Elon Musk is heavily hinting at a commercial release of the Neuralink implantable chips. This can be a breakthrough in the treatment of psychological illnesses that have no definitive cure.  

So, the question is, how can Neuralink be effective in curing conditions like addiction and depression, among others? If perfected, the implanted Neuralink brain chip will directly converse with the brain without interacting with one’s senses. This direct contact can be used to retrain the synapses and reverse behaviors that give rise to the mind’s afflictions.  

Talking about the fact that Elon Musk deemed this revolutionary technology scary, it seems like Neuralink is his attempt to counter the looming dangers of Artificial Intelligence, as he made clear several times. 

According to Elon Musk, Neuralink will act as a bridge between AI and humanity, giving the former the much-needed human element without which its progression he claims is equivalent to ‘summoning the demon.’ There is hope that Neuralink will cure depression, and brain diseases such as Parkinson’s and may even be used to interact with other humans merely through thoughts. 

Going back to his intriguing tweet,

Elon Musk reflected on how ‘Everything we’ve ever sensed or thought has been electrical signals. The early universe was just a soup of quarks & leptons. How did a very small piece of the Universe start to think of itself as sentient?’ 

This only goes to show the genius of Elon Musk and the impending reality of the brain to computer communication. Much has been said about Neuralink, but the details have remained shrouded in mystery until Musk’s latest tweets. It looks like the secrets are slowly unraveling. 

Musk had earlier revealed in a podcast with Joe Rogan, how Neuralink would achieve brain implantation. He spoke about it, stating,

‘We would basically take out a chunk of your skull and put the Neuralink device in there. You insert the electrode threads very carefully in the brain, and then you stitch it. It would interface anywhere in the brain, and it could restore your eyesight and limb functionalities’.

The company is undoubtedly seeking to achieve the impossible by attempting to merge Artificial Intelligence and humans. More information on Neuralink will cure depression is awaited over the next months.
